About 68 East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

68 East Street is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Gillingham (ME7 1EH). It has a recorded floor area of 84 m² (around 904 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(November 2020)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ump.

Across 1996–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£210,000 is 12.5% below the 2025 sale of £240,000, below the original sale price, which typically signals condition or completion-status changes worth verifying.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£265/sq ft) was about 86.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. A recent sale: £240,000 in April 2025.
